Nissan has decided to officially demonstrate just how committed
they are to making their GT-R sportscar a true supercar with the release of performance
and price figures. The GT-Rs 3.8L twin
turbo V6 will be producing 473 horsepower and 434 ft-lbs of torque. If that doesnt seem like enough for you, youve
underestimated the delivery of such raw Asian fury. Through the aid of an all-wheel drive, GR6 dual
clutch six-speed and paddle shifted automatic, the 0-60mph time will be a mere 3.5
seconds. Expect quarter mile times in
the 11.7 second range and a top speed of 192 mph. For those in the market, anticipate a base
MSRP starting below $80,000. At this
performance level, Porsche 911 Turbos are scared; at this price, Z06s are
